How does this partnership compare to similar crypto‑payment initiatives within the travel or tourism industry?

Comparative Landscape

The Shift4 – Blue Origin deal is the first high‑ticket‑price, experience‑based travel offering that directly integrates crypto and stable‑coin checkout for a “space‑flight” product. By contrast, most crypto‑payment pilots in the tourism sector have been low‑margin, volume‑driven – e‑commerce travel platforms such as Travala.com, airline pilots (AirBaltic, LATAM) and boutique hotel chains that simply added a Bitcoin or USDC gateway to capture a niche‑tech‑savvy traveler. Those initiatives are largely marketing‑centric and have modest impact on the underlying payment‑processor revenues because the average transaction size is in the $200‑$1,500 range and the crypto share of total bookings remains sub‑1 %.
